    I'm afraid that is illegal, not to mention very immoral.

    You cannot target someone for dismissal based on their political affiliation.

    If you are genuinely going to face layoffs, and I really think you should wait to see if anything does actually change, you should lay off the least essential workers. Otherwise, you'll be harming your business both by laying off decent workers and facing several lawsuits.
